VIDEO: Michelle Grattan on the Pacific Islands Forum wash-up, media freedom and the public service

Michelle Grattan talks to University of Canberra Vice-Chancellor and President Professor Deep Saini about the week in politics, including Australia’s role at the Pacific Islands Forum, the inquiry into media freedom and how the Morrison government might deal with the public service.
